Output ed2c2560614bf9f247f793119df9455ef81ae8c94b49855cba012f91e5353a59:0

value
21403227
script pubkey
OP_HASH160 OP_PUSHBYTES_20 464d0aad91c048f4d8b25e7f25a77d89e244d672 OP_EQUAL
address
MEJspowtsYDpUXowHYyhMfJZDeyfqdcu7D
transaction
ed2c2560614bf9f247f793119df9455ef81ae8c94b49855cba012f91e5353a59
spent
true